Postcode B46 2RH is located in a rural village, within the Fillongley ward of North Warwickshire in the West Midlands region , and forms part of the New Arley & Fillongley area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 117.8 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income of residents in New Arley & Fillongley is £46,700 per year. The nearest station is Coleshill Parkway located about 2.0 miles away. There are 1 primary and no secondary schools in the area.
